If you haven’t already guessed, this artifact is related to laundry. Laundry has been a part of human life for thousands of years, though the methods have evolved significantly over time. In the past, people would take their soiled clothes to the nearest river and beat them against rocks to remove dirt and stains. Nowadays, we have the convenience of throwing our clothes into a washing machine, which completes the task in just an hour.

The device depicted in these pictures played a crucial role in making laundry less laborious. Considering the numerous steps involved in the process – from hauling and boiling water, to washing, rinsing, wringing clothes, and drying them – doing laundry was quite an undertaking.
